Bear Canyon Bridge Public Art Lighting Project

New blue lights on I-25 bike and pedestrian bridge!
The public art lighting installation was recently tested and successful. The lighting design that pays homage to the flowing waters of Bear Canyon will be on permanently starting at dusk, Friday, May 24th, 2013. Read the Fact Sheet for more information. 5/15/13
